In the ever-evolving landscape of healthcare, the integration of artificial intelligence (AI) into payvider operations and patient care stands as a beacon of innovation and efficiency. Payviders, entities that both provide care and pay for the incurred expenses, are uniquely positioned to leverage AI to improve healthcare outcomes, reduce costs, and enhance patient experiences. This article delves into how AI is reshaping payvider operations, from administrative tasks to direct patient care, and outlines the challenges and opportunities that lie ahead.

Streamlining Administrative Tasks

Automation of Billing and Claims Processing

One of the most significant applications of AI in payvider operations is the automation of billing and claims processing. Traditionally, these tasks have been labor-intensive, prone to human error, and a source of delays in reimbursement. AI-driven systems can parse vast amounts of billing data, identify discrepancies, and automate routine tasks, thereby reducing errors and speeding up the claims process. This not only improves operational efficiency but also enhances the financial sustainability of payvider organizations.

Predictive Analytics in Healthcare Management

AI's ability to analyze large datasets extends to predictive analytics, where it can forecast trends in healthcare utilization, patient admissions, and potential health outbreaks. By predicting high-demand periods, payviders can better allocate resources, staff, and inventory, ensuring that patient care is not compromised due to resource constraints. Furthermore, predictive analytics can identify patients at high risk of chronic diseases or readmission, allowing for early interventions and personalized care plans.

Enhancing Patient Care

Personalized Treatment Plans

AI's role in patient care is transformative, offering personalized and precision medicine. By analyzing patient data, including genetic information, lifestyle factors, and previous health records, AI algorithms can suggest tailored treatment plans that are more likely to be effective for the individual patient. This personalized approach not only improves health outcomes but also enhances patient satisfaction and engagement in their care process.

Virtual Health Assistants and Telemedicine

AI-powered virtual health assistants and telemedicine platforms have made healthcare more accessible, especially in remote or underserved areas. These technologies can provide preliminary consultations, answer patient queries, and monitor patient health remotely, reducing the need for in-person visits. For payviders, this means an expanded reach and the ability to offer continuous care, improving patient outcomes and satisfaction.

Challenges and Ethical Considerations

Data Privacy and Security

The implementation of AI in healthcare raises significant concerns regarding data privacy and security. Payviders must ensure that patient data, especially sensitive health information, is protected against breaches and unauthorized access. Adhering to regulations such as the Health Insurance Portability and Accountability Act (HIPAA) in the United States is crucial in maintaining patient trust and compliance with legal standards.

Bias and Fairness in AI Algorithms

Another challenge is the potential for bias in AI algorithms, which can lead to disparities in patient care. It is essential that AI systems are trained on diverse datasets to ensure that they are fair and effective across different populations. Payviders must be vigilant in monitoring AI systems for bias and continuously update them to reflect a broad spectrum of patient demographics.

Future Directions

The future of AI in payvider operations and patient care is promising, with ongoing advancements in technology opening new avenues for innovation. The integration of AI with other emerging technologies, such as the Internet of Medical Things (IoMT) and blockchain, could further enhance data interoperability, security, and patient-centric care.
